Where is Playa de Matalascañas?
Where is Playa de Matalascañas located?
Playa de Matalascañas, Playa de Matalascañas, Spain (approx. 36.99645°, -6.55339°)
Where is Playa de Matalascañas on the map?
Playa de Matalascañas - Seville
{"latitude":36.99645,"longitude":-6.55339,"title":"Playa de Matalascañas"}